    Default Star match-ups (by position) the league just missed out on.

    What are some superstar match-ups that we just missed by a few months? Players have to retire the same year the other was drafted (or in the case of David Robinson) played their first game. So Wilt vs. Walton wont work. Wilt was out of the league a whole season before Walton entered the league.



    George Mikan vs. Bill Russell: Mikan retires in 56 and Russell is drafted that season.

    Maurice Stokes vs. Elgin Baylor: 1958 They're obviously peers. Russell had Wilt, West had Oscar, these guys were supposed to have each other.

    Bill Russell vs. Lew Alcindor: 1969 Just like Russell just missed Mikan, Alcindor just missed Russell.

    Connie Hawkins vs. Julius Erving: 1976 They faced off against each other on Harlem playgrounds just no in the NBA.

    Elvin Hayes vs. Charles Barkley: 1984 The new age PF taking over.

    Kareem Abdul-Jabbar vs. David Robinson: 1989 They would have battled had David come out his draft year of 1987.

    Kevin McHale vs. Chris Webber: 1993 Who wins this battler?

    Isiah Thomas vs. Jason Kidd: 1994 The changing of the guard.

    James Worthy vs. Grant Hill: 1994 Would be fun to watch.

    Moses Malone vs. Kevin Garnett: 1995 High School Battle.

    Clyde Drexler vs. Vince Carter: 1998 The new wave of a high flyer.

    Hakeem Olajuwon vs. Yao Ming: 2002 New Houston vs. Old Houston.

    Michael Jordan vs. LeBron James: 2003 What needs to be said.
